source: abuse/tags/pd/imlib/configure.in @ 597

Last change on this file since 597 was 49, checked in by Sam Hocevar, 15 years ago
  • Imported original public domain release, for future reference.
File size: 957 bytes
RevLine 
[49]1AC_INIT(jwindow.c)
2AM_INIT_AUTOMAKE(imlib, 2.0)
3AC_PROG_CC
4AC_PROG_CPP
5AC_PROG_CXX
6AC_PROG_RANLIB
7AC_CANONICAL_HOST
8
9AC_PATH_XTRA
10
11# Do we have X shared memory support?
12AC_CHECK_LIB(Xext,XShmAttach,:,[
13AC_CHECK_LIB(XextSam,XShmAttach,:,AC_DEFINE(NO_XSHM),$X_LIBS -lX11 -lXext)
14],$X_LIBS -lX11)
15
16JOYSTICK=port/unix/joystick.o
17SOUND=port/unix/sound.o
18TIMING=port/unix/timing.o
19LIBSVGA=
20case ${host} in
21  *-*-linux*)
22        JOYSTICK=port/linux/joystick.o
23        SOUND=port/sgi/sound.o
24        AC_CHECK_HEADER(vga.h,LIBSVGA=libsvgawin.a,)
25        ;;
26  mips-sgi-irix*)
27        SOUND=port/sgi/sound.o
28        TIMING=port/sgi/timing.o
29        ;;
30  powerpc-*-aix4*)
31        SOUND=port/aix/sound.o
32        ;;
33  *)
34        ;;
35esac
36AC_SUBST(JOYSTICK)
37AC_SUBST(SOUND)
38AC_SUBST(TIMING)
39AC_SUBST(LIBSVGA)
40
41AC_CHECK_FUNCS(atexit on_exit, break)
42AB_C_BIGENDIAN
43
44AC_LANG_SAVE
45AC_LANG_CPLUSPLUS
46AB_ADD_FLAGS(-fno-exceptions -fno-rtti)
47AC_LANG_RESTORE
48
49mkdir -p port/unix port/x11 port/svga port/linux port/sgi port/aix
50
51AC_OUTPUT(Makefile)
Note: See TracBrowser for help on using the repository browser.